What are your feelings on parallel universes?
Mark Oliver Everett, front man of alt-rock band The Eels, is the son of the physicist (Hugh Everett III) who came up with the idea. Apparently the latter came up with the concept as a young man and achieved fame, had his theories trashed later, and then in the 70’s his theories were re-examined and he became a huge celebrity again. Then he died. Nova put out an amazing documentary on all this. It’s set against the backdrop of his relationship with his son (Mark Oliver), whom a camera crew follows as he learns about the whole thing by talking with historians and physicists. All set to great Eels music. Very heartbreaking because of all the tragedy of the family, but it’s very sweet, too, and it’s a great intro to the physics behind parallel universes.
